Upper Luzira Prison has registered an improvement in the performance of the inmates who sat for the 2016 primary leaving exams compared to 2015.
According to the results which were released yesterday by Uganda National Examination Board, out of the 77 candidates who registered, 69 Candidate sat with 2 obtaining division 1 and 32 obtaining Division 2 with 3 ungraded.
Speaking to kfm, the spokesperson of Luzira Prison service Frank Baine says that there has a remarkably improvement in the performance of their inmates with 2 being in the first Division, 32 in division in 2016 and from the 1 they had in first division in 2015 with 20 in division two respectively.
He explains that the prison has been able to give education to inmates from kindergarten level to university to enable those who could not access education while out to also acquire knowledge at no costs
He noted that he expects that these people will continue to ungraded their education to secondary leave until they are released.
